    Moly coating bullets

    Is there a company that will coat bullets with Moly?

    Example....I'll send them 1000 rounds of 9mm XTP uncoated bullets and they will coat them with Moly.

    You don't give a location, so it's more difficult to give you an answer. However, the shipping to and from the coater, plus his cost would probably not make it worthwhile. You can get a moly coating kit and do it yourself. If you're close to a bullet manufacturer and hand carry your bullets, they might do it for you.

          I used the Lyman kit when I used to plate my bullets. It came with a tumbler bowl, ceramic media and the moly powder. I got good results and will take the Pepsi challenge against SSS coated bullets. The key is to properly clean your bullets before coating.

          I don't coat my bullets any more since I got tired of the hassle and mess. The latest bullet coating craze is with hexagon Boron Nitride.
